Standard Specification for Nuclear-Grade Aluminum Oxide Powder

This specification provides the chemical and physical properties and requirements for nuclear-grade aluminum oxide powder intended for fabrication into shapes for nuclear applications. The materials shall conform to physical requirements as to particle size distribution, and specific surface area, and chemical requirements as to loss-on-ignition, and total and elemental concentrations of all impurities. Impurities may include silicaon, iron-chromium-nickel, magnesium, sodium, calcium, hafnium, fluorine, fluorine-chlorine-iodine-bromine, gadolinium, samarium, europium, and dysprosium.
Scope
1.1 This specification provides the chemical and physical requirements for nuclear-grade aluminum oxide powder intended for fabrication into shapes for nuclear applications. Two specific uses for which this powder is intended are Al2O3 pellets and Al2O3 − B4C composite pellets for use as thermal insulator or burnable neutron absorbers, respectively.
1.2 The material described herein shall be particulate in nature.
